Once Upon a Time in the Bible
This is a unique, captivating and educational collection of 37 biblical stories that focuses on the lives of famous and infamous Bible characters. Each story highlights key virtues to emulate and mistakes to avoid, making it an excellent resource for children and young adults alike.
The stories are organized alphabetically, beginning with Aaron and ending with Solomon. Each narrative is concise and easy to read, making it accessible to young readers. The collection is accompanied by an activity at the end of each story, which encourages children to search for the meanings of specific words listed.
The book also includes a Bible text where the name of the character being narrated is mentioned, providing readers with an opportunity for more detailed study.
